Azure CanadaPubSecALZ 项目使用教程
1. 项目的目录结构及介绍
CanadaPubSecALZ/
├── docs/
│ └── architecture/
│ └── md
├── scripts/
│ └── tests/
├── .gitignore
├── CODE_OF_CONDUCT.md
├── CONTRIBUTING.md
├── LICENSE
├── README.md
├── SECURITY.md
├── SUPPORT.md
├── bicepconfig.json
└── ...
目录结构介绍
- docs/: 包含项目的文档,特别是架构文档。
- scripts/: 包含项目的脚本文件,通常用于自动化任务。
- tests/: 包含项目的测试脚本或测试用例。
- .gitignore: 指定Git应忽略的文件和目录。
- CODE_OF_CONDUCT.md: 项目的代码行为准则。
- CONTRIBUTING.md: 贡献指南,指导开发者如何为项目做出贡献。
- LICENSE: 项目的开源许可证。
- README.md: 项目的主文档,通常包含项目的基本信息和使用说明。
- SECURITY.md: 项目的安全指南和报告漏洞的流程。
- SUPPORT.md: 项目的技术支持信息。
- bicepconfig.json: Bicep配置文件,用于Azure资源管理。
2. 项目的启动文件介绍
README.md
README.md
是项目的启动文件,通常包含以下内容:
- 项目简介: 介绍项目的目的和主要功能。
- 安装指南: 指导用户如何安装和配置项目。
- 使用说明: 提供项目的基本使用方法和示例。
- 贡献指南: 指导开发者如何为项目做出贡献。
- 许可证信息: 说明项目的开源许可证。
3. 项目的配置文件介绍
bicepconfig.json
bicepconfig.json
是Bicep配置文件,用于定义Azure资源管理的相关配置。该文件通常包含以下内容:
- 目标环境: 指定部署的目标Azure环境。
- 资源组: 定义资源组的配置。
- 资源定义: 详细定义要部署的Azure资源。
- 参数: 定义部署过程中需要提供的参数。
.gitignore
.gitignore
文件用于指定Git应忽略的文件和目录,通常包含以下内容:
- 临时文件: 如
*.tmp
、*.log
等。 - 编译输出: 如
bin/
、obj/
等。 - IDE配置文件: 如
.vscode/
、.idea/
等。 - 敏感信息: 如
.env
、secrets/
等。
LICENSE
LICENSE
文件包含项目的开源许可证信息,通常包含以下内容:
- 许可证类型: 如MIT、Apache等。
- 许可证文本: 包含完整的许可证条款和条件。
CONTRIBUTING.md
CONTRIBUTING.md
文件包含项目的贡献指南,通常包含以下内容:
- 贡献流程: 指导开发者如何提交代码和报告问题。
- 代码风格: 定义项目的代码风格和编码规范。
- 测试指南: 指导开发者如何运行和编写测试。
SECURITY.md
SECURITY.md
文件包含项目的安全指南,通常包含以下内容:
- 安全政策: 定义项目的安全政策和漏洞报告流程。
- 安全建议: 提供项目的安全使用建议。
- 漏洞报告: 指导用户如何报告安全漏洞。
SUPPORT.md
SUPPORT.md
文件包含项目的技术支持信息,通常包含以下内容:
- 支持渠道: 提供项目的技术支持渠道,如邮件列表、论坛等。
- 常见问题: 列出常见问题及其解决方案。
- 联系信息: 提供项目维护者的联系信息。
通过以上内容,您可以全面了解Azure CanadaPubSecALZ项目的目录结构、启动文件和配置文件。